Ann Sather is located in the Lakeview neighborhood at 909 W. Belmont Ave. You can make reservations at 773-348-2378. They are offering a four-course dinner menu, including the restaurant's signature cinnamon rolls. On the menu you will find roast turkey *** with celery dressing, broiled salmon with mustard dill sauce, beef tenderloin with grilled mushrooms, and pecan pie just to name a few.
R.J. Grunts is located in the Lincoln Park Neighborhood at 2056 N Lincoln Park West. You can make reservations at 773-929-5363. They are offering an all-you-can-eat brunch for $14.95 on Sunday from 10 a.m.-2 p.m. R.J.Grungs is a fun and high-energy restaurant, which serves as a time capsule of the early '80s. The brunch consists of tasty breakfast items placed on either side of the core salad fixings. The Denver scramble is very satisfying and the super-long chicken sausage links is a peppery pick-me-up. There are mini-Belgian waffles and pecan-praline French toast on the menu too.
